Background
The pH value is usually measured when analyzing the water quality of the water for fish culture; the concentration of hydrogen ions has been considered as an important factor in the quality of fish farming water, affecting the production of fish farming in several ways. The specification of the comparative document CN102313735A of the kit and the detection method thereof for rapidly detecting the pH value of the water for fishery culture refers to the kit for rapidly detecting the pH value of the water for fishery culture, and is characterized in that the kit is internally provided with: 10ml cuvette with plug: 1; color chart: 1; suction pipe: 1; 20ml dropping bottle: 1; acid-base indicator: 20ml ", but the kit in the comparison document is inconvenient to carry out, and simultaneously the pipette, the dropping bottle, the cuvette and the colorimetric card which are taken out are inconvenient to place stably, and the use is not safe, convenient and reliable.

Referring to fig. 1-4, the utility model provides a kit for rapidly detecting the PH of water quality, which comprises an outer kit sleeve 1, a kit body 3 and an inner mounting frame 4; the outer box cover 1 is sleeved outside the kit body 3, a group of inserting sheets 2 are respectively arranged at the left part and the right part of the outer box cover 1, the inner mounting frame 4 is arranged in the kit body 3, the middle part of the inner mounting frame 4 is sleeved with the dropping bottle 5, the dropper 6 and the cuvette 7 are respectively sleeved at the left part and the right part of the inner mounting frame 4, and the cuvette 7 is positioned at the outer side of the dropper 6. The middle part of the upper end surface of the outer box sleeve 1 is provided with a storage bag 10, the upper end surface of the storage bag 10 is provided with a magic tape adhesive surface 13, a flip cover 12 is adhered on the magic tape adhesive surface 13, and meanwhile, the storage bag 10 is internally provided with a color comparison card 11. The color chart 11 is conveniently loaded in the storage bag 10, the upper end face of the storage bag 10 is turned over by the turning cover 12, the magic tape surface is arranged on the inner side face of the turning cover 12, the magic tape is conveniently attached to the magic tape surface 13, and the color chart is also conveniently opened or attached, so that the use is more convenient and trouble-saving. The left and right parts of the bottom surface of the outer box sleeve 1 are provided with bases 14, the upper sides of the left and right parts of the outer box sleeve 1 are provided with upper jacks 15, and the lower sides of the left and right parts of the outer box sleeve 1 are provided with lower jacks 16; the inserting sheet 2 is inserted between the upper jack 15 and the lower jack 16 on the same side, and the inserting sheet 2 is connected with the upper jack 15 and the lower jack 16 in a split mode. The upper inserting sheet 2 is inserted between the upper inserting holes 15 and the lower inserting holes 16 at the left and right parts of the outer box sleeve 1, so as to stabilize the reagent box body 3 sleeved in the outer box sleeve 1, ensure that the installation is more stable and reliable, avoid sliding out from two sides, and simultaneously facilitate the taking out of the inserting sheet 2, and at the moment, facilitate the taking out of the reagent box body 3 from the outer box sleeve 1. The bottom of the inner mounting frame 4 is provided with a vibration reduction base plate 40, the middle part of the upper end surface of the vibration reduction base plate 40 is provided with a middle groove 41, the left and right parts of the upper end surface of the vibration reduction base plate 40 are provided with side grooves 42, the left and right ends of the vibration reduction base plate 40 are respectively fixed with a side fixing plate 43, the upper ends of the side fixing plates 43 are fixed under an upper mounting plate 46, the middle part of the upper mounting plate 46 is provided with a middle sleeve hole 48, and the left and right parts of the upper mounting plate 46 are respectively provided with a second side sleeve hole 47 and a first side sleeve hole 45; the dropper bottle 5 is nested within the middle nest hole 48 on the inner mount 4, the dropper tube 6 is nested within the second side nest hole 47 on the inner mount 4, and the cuvette 7 is nested within the first side nest hole 45 on the inner mount 4. The setting of interior mounting bracket 4 is convenient wholly to take out in the kit body 3, also is convenient for lay, and the cover of the convenient dropping bottle 5 of setting up of interior mounting bracket 4, burette 6 and cuvette 7 is put simultaneously is put, sets up more nimble convenience to carry out PH short-term test to quality of water, more convenient and practical.
